Notes:

Statement 1 is incorrect: They are ‘Endangered’ as per the IUCN Red List. Irrawaddy dolphins fall under Schedule I of the Indian Wildlife (Protection) Act, 1972

Statement 2 is correct: Dolphin distribution in Chilika is considered to be the highest single lagoon population. However, recently there has been a dip in Chilika lake dolphin population. Whereas, overall numbers in Odisha have increased.

Also found in coastal areas in South and Southeast Asia, and in three rivers: the Irrawaddy (Myanmar), the Mahakam (Indonesian Borneo) and the Mekong (China).
